logo

Output d59aa65ad1c471513b736c9a1ebe259153a43f8f3ea5646d461c50f2c619d2fb:23

value
2865842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e63e2e3713f2e7eb68c2f06800c64e800030116 OP_EQUAL
address
3AJ76o9Rvithu8rdxYPffNj53zmUTVbmfc
transaction
d59aa65ad1c471513b736c9a1ebe259153a43f8f3ea5646d461c50f2c619d2fb